深入解析:编程脚本编写方法与技巧全面覆开发流程与实践
一、引言
随着人工智能技术的飞速发展编程脚本已经成为开发者们必备的技能之一。脚本不仅可以增进开发效率还能优化程序性能使得应用更加智能化、个性化。本文将深入解析编程脚本的编写方法与技巧全面覆开发流程与实践帮助开发者们更好地掌握编程脚本。
二、编程脚本编写方法
1. 选择合适的编程语言
目前主流的编程语言有Python、Java、C 等。Python因其简洁易懂、库丰富、社区活跃等特点成为编程的首选语言。选择合适的编程语言有利于增进开发效率减低学成本。
2. 熟悉框架与库
熟悉常用的框架与库如TensorFlow、PyTorch、Keras等,可以帮助开发者快速搭建实小编,增强开发效率。这些框架与库提供了丰富的API,开发者只需熟悉其基本用法,即可实现复杂的功能。
3. 掌握数据预应对技巧
数据预应对是编程的关键环节。开发者需要熟悉怎样应对缺失值、异常值、数据标准化、数据归一化等方法,以提升数据优劣,为后续模型训练打下坚实基础。
4. 编写模块化代码
编写模块化代码有利于增进代码的可读性、可维护性和可复用性。开发者应将功能相近的代码块封装成函数或类,便于管理和复用。
5. 调试与优化
在编程进展中,调试与优化是必不可少的环节。开发者需要掌握调试工具的采用,如断点调试、日志输出等,以便快速定位疑惑。同时通过优化代码结构、算法和时间复杂度,增强程序性能。
三、脚本插件利用方法
1. 安装与配置
开发者需要安装对应的脚本插件,如TensorFlow、PyTorch等。安装完成后,依据插件须要实配置,如设置环境变量、安装依库等。
2. 调用API
脚本插件提供了丰富的API,开发者能够通过调用这些API实现功能。调用API时,需熟悉API的参数含义、返回值类型等,确信正确采用。
3. 参数调整与优化
在利用脚本插件时,开发者需要依据实际需求调整参数,如学率、批次大小等。通过调整参数,优化模型性能。
4. 模型训练与评估
利用脚本插件实模型训练和评估,开发者需要编写相应的训练代码和评估代码,以验证模型效果。
四、编程实践
1. 代码规范
编写规范的代码有利于升级代码优劣,减少维护成本。开发者应遵循PEP8等代码规范,保持代码简洁、易读。
2. 文档编写
编写详细的文档,有助于他人理解和复用代码。文档应包含函数说明、类注释、示例代码等。
3. 单元测试
编写单元测试,确信代码的健壮性和可维护性。单元测试应覆各种边界条件和异常情况。
4. 代码版本控制
利用代码版本控制工具,如Git,有利于代码的协作开发、版本管理和备份。开发者应熟练掌握Git等版本控制工具的采用。
5. 持续集成与持续部署
采用持续集成(CI)和持续部署(CD)策略,自动化构建、测试和部署应用,提升开发效率。
五、结语
本文从编程脚本编写方法、技巧、插件采用方法以及实践等方面实行了深入解析,旨在帮助开发者们更好地掌握编程脚本。随着人工智能技术的不断进步,编程脚本将发挥越来越关键的作用,掌握这一技能将有助于开发者在领域取得更高的成就。